The pair have been kept busy designing the upgraded facade of the Warrnambool Art Gallery.
The renovation, Once women won the vote is expected to be completed by May.

Inspired by the 1891 ‘Monster Petition’ in Victoria, the artwork will mark the time in history when Warrnambool’s women fought for the right to vote.
